Shirley M. Shultz, 78, of Edinburgh, died at 11 a.m. Tuesday, April 10, 2012, at Columbus Regional Hospital. Mrs. Shultz was a homemaker and former secretary for Bartholomew County Extension Office. She also worked for RCA in Bloomington, was a school bus driver in Brown County and helped with family farming. She was a member of New Hope Christian Church, had been a 4-H leader in Brown County and a Sunday school teacher at Beck's Grove Christian Church. She enjoyed working crossword puzzles. Born in Sedalia, Mo., July 24, 1933, Mrs. Shultz was the daughter of Edward O. and Amelia Wint Stuckey. She is survived by daughters, Juanita Belser and Rhonda (Gary) Hornung. both of Edinburgh, and Regina (John) King of Elizabethtown; a brother, Roy (Fran) Stuckey of Navaree, Fla.; five grandchildren; and one great-granddaughter. She was preceded in death by a son, Charles A. Shultz; a sister, Margie Reeves; and a brother, Robert Stuckey.
